What Exactly Is an Emergency Electrician?

An emergency electrician is your 24/7 electrical first responder. Unlike scheduled technicians who handle installations and upgrades during business hours, these pros are on call nights, weekends, and holidays to tackle dangerous, urgent problems that can't wait. They are trained to diagnose and fix critical issues rapidly, prioritizing safety above all else. For homeowners in the Spring Creek or Maple Ridge areas, this means having a expert who can respond when a problem strikes at 2 AM on a Saturday, preventing potential fires or prolonged power loss.

Is This Really an Emergency? Knowing When to Call

Not every electrical hiccup requires an immediate, after-hours call. Let's break down what truly constitutes an electrical emergency in our community.

Call 911 FIRST, then call an emergency electrician if you experience:

  • Visible sparks, smoke, or flames coming from an outlet, switch, or appliance.
  • The persistent smell of burning plastic or overheated wires—a common issue in older Mapleton homes with outdated wiring.
  • A buzzing, sizzling, or crackling sound from your electrical panel or walls.
  • Power outages isolated to just your home when neighbors have power, especially if you hear a pop from your panel.
  • Exposed, damaged, or frayed wires that are accessible.
  • Any electrical issue combined with the smell of natural gas.

It's serious, but you can likely call during normal hours for:

  • A single dead outlet or light switch.
  • Frequent but minor breaker trips on a single circuit.
  • Minor flickering of lights during high winds (common in the foothills).

During a summer storm in Mapleton, it's not uncommon for a heavy branch to damage the service drop—the line from the pole to your house. If that line is down and arcing, that's a double emergency: call Rocky Mountain Power at 1-888-221-7070 to cut power at the pole, then call us for the repair.

Why Mapleton Homes Face Unique Electrical Risks

Our local climate and housing stock directly influence the kinds of emergencies we see. Mapleton's beautiful seasons bring specific challenges:

  • Summer Storms & Surges: Afternoon thunderstorms can send powerful surges through the grid. Homes with older, ungrounded wiring or undersized panels near the bench areas are particularly vulnerable to damage from these spikes.
  • Winter Freezes & Heavy Snow: The weight of snow and ice can strain overhead lines. Older homes with 60- or 100-amp panels from the 1960s and 70s are often overloaded by modern heating systems, leading to overheated breakers.
  • Older Wiring Systems: In neighborhoods with homes built before 1970, you might still find aluminum branch circuit wiring, which can loosen at connections and overheat over time. Knob-and-tube wiring, while less common, is a definite fire hazard and a priority for upgrade.
  • Soil & Foundation Shifts: Mapleton's soil composition can lead to subtle foundation movement over time, which may stretch or damage underground service lines to outbuildings or yard lights.

Understanding the Cost of Emergency Electrical Service in Mapleton

We believe in transparency. Yes, emergency services cost more than a scheduled appointment, and for good reason. You're paying for immediate mobilization, priority dispatch, and the expertise to solve high-pressure problems quickly and safely. Here’s a breakdown of what goes into the total price, based on current local market rates verified for Utah County.

Typical Cost Components:

  • Emergency Call-Out/Dispatch Fee: This is a flat fee to mobilize a truck and certified technician to your address, regardless of the job's complexity. In Mapleton, this typically ranges from $100 to $200.
  • After-Hours Premium: Work performed outside standard business hours (usually weekdays 8 AM–5 PM) incurs a labor multiplier. Expect rates to be 1.5 to 2.5 times the standard hourly rate.
  • Hourly Labor Rate: The standard hourly rate for a licensed electrician in Utah County ranges from $80 to $120 per hour. During an emergency, the applied rate includes the after-hours premium.
  • Parts & Materials: Breakers, wiring, conduit, and fixtures are charged at retail cost plus a standard markup.
  • Travel/Distance Fee: For homes in more remote parts of Mapleton or the surrounding canyons, a small travel fee may apply to account for fuel and time.

Real-World Cost Scenarios:

  • Midnight Breaker Panel Repair: A failed main breaker causing a total house outage on a Saturday night might involve a $150 call-out, 2 hours of labor at an emergency rate ($240), and a $200 part. Total Estimate: ~$590.
  • Weekend Outlet Replacement: A smoking outlet on a Sunday afternoon could be a $125 call-out, 1 hour of emergency labor ($120), and a $25 receptacle. Total Estimate: ~$270.
  • Storm Damage Assessment: A diagnostic visit after a storm to check for surge damage throughout the house might be a standard call-out fee plus an hourly rate for the inspection.

Your Step-by-Step Safety Plan Until Help Arrives

If you suspect an electrical emergency, your actions in the first few minutes are critical.

  1. Stay Calm & Assess: Identify the source without touching anything. Look for smoke, listen for sounds.
  2. Cut Power if Safe: If the problem is isolated to an appliance (like a heater), unplug it from the outlet. If it's a circuit-wide issue, go to your panel and flip the corresponding breaker to OFF. Only shut off the main breaker if you feel the entire house is at risk and you know how to do it safely.
  3. Evacuate & Call: If you see flames or smell strong burning, get everyone out of the house immediately and call 911 from a safe distance. Then call your emergency electrician.
  4. Call the Utility for External Issues: For downed power lines or problems at the meter, call Rocky Mountain Power. Stay at least 30 feet away from any downed line.
  5. Prepare for the Electrician: Clear a path to your electrical panel and the problem area. Have a flashlight handy. Be ready to describe what happened, what you heard/smelled, and what you've already done.

Choosing the Right Emergency Electrician in Your Area

Not all electricians offer true 24/7 emergency service. When choosing who to trust with your home's safety, look for:

  • 24/7 Availability: A dedicated emergency line answered by a person, not just a voicemail.
  • Local Presence: Companies based in or near Mapleton (like us!) have faster response times. We aim for a 60- to 90-minute arrival window for most emergencies in central Mapleton, though severe weather or remote locations can affect this.
  • Proper Licensing & Insurance: Always verify an electrician holds a current Utah Journeyman or Master Electrician license and carries liability insurance.
  • Transparent Pricing: Willingness to discuss call-out fees and rates upfront.
  • Knowledge of Local Codes: Mapleton follows the National Electrical Code (NEC) as adopted by the State of Utah, with local amendments. Emergency repairs often still require a permit from the Utah County Building Department for work like panel replacements or new circuit runs—a legitimate electrician will handle this.
